What's Cable's answer to fixed wireless? Every cable bull I've read has dismissed it as a competitive threat, but T-Mobile and Verizon adding fixed wireless pretty quickly now
Verizon's 5g home internet goes up to gigabit speeds for like $35/month and $25 a month for 300 mbps with 10 year price locks. T-Mobile offers something similar. These services are much cheaper than Charter's non promotional pricing.
The cable story doesn't work if there's real competition. Margins will get squeezed. Verizon and T-Mobile can "lose" but absolutely trash Charter's margins. I expect broadband prices in the US to fall in the coming 24 months.
